import unittest
from setools import SELinuxPolicy, TypeAttributeQuery
class TypeAttributeQueryTest(unittest.TestCase):
@classmethod
def setUpClass(cls):
cls.p = SELinuxPolicy("tests/typeattrquery.conf")
def test_000_unset(self):
"""Type attribute query with no criteria."""
# query with no parameters gets all attrs.
allattrs = sorted(self.p.typeattributes())
q = TypeAttributeQuery(self.p)
qattrs = sorted(q.results())
self.assertListEqual(allattrs, qattrs)
def test_001_name_exact(self):
"""Type attribute query with exact name match."""
q = TypeAttributeQuery(self.p, name="test1")
attrs = sorted(str(t) for t in q.results())
self.assertListEqual(["test1"], attrs)
def test_002_name_regex(self):
"""Type attribute query with regex name match."""
q = TypeAttributeQuery(self.p, name="test2(a|b)", name_regex=True)
attrs = sorted(str(t) for t in q.results())
self.assertListEqual(["test2a", "test2b"], attrs)
def test_010_type_set_intersect(self):
"""Type attribute query with type set intersection."""
q = TypeAttributeQuery(self.p, types=["test10t1", "test10t7"])
attrs = sorted(str(t) for t in q.results())
self.assertListEqual(["test10a", "test10c"], attrs)
def test_011_type_set_equality(self):
"""Type attribute query with type set equality."""
q = TypeAttributeQuery(self.p, types=["test11t1", "test11t2",
"test11t3", "test11t5"], types_equal=True)
attrs = sorted(str(t) for t in q.results())
self.assertListEqual(["test11a"], attrs)
def test_012_type_set_regex(self):
"""Type attribute query with type set regex match."""
q = TypeAttributeQuery(self.p, types="test12t(1|2)", types_regex=True)
attrs = sorted(str(t) for t in q.results())
self.assertListEqual(["test12a", "test12b"], attrs)
